The topological pigeonhole principle for ordinals

Logic 2016-07-14 v4

Abstract

Given a cardinal κ\kappa and a sequence (αi)iκ\left(\alpha_i\right)_{i\in\kappa} of ordinals, we determine the least ordinal β\beta (when one exists) such that the topological partition relation β(topαi)iκ1\beta\rightarrow\left(top\,\alpha_i\right)^1_{i\in\kappa} holds, including an independence result for one class of cases. Here the prefix "toptop" means that the homogeneous set must have the correct topology rather than the correct order type. The answer is linked to the non-topological pigeonhole principle of Milner and Rado.
